Because I made it myself Well, seriously, when I started searching for an entry level TT years ago, I was mainly looking at the cost, rather than function.... so it's a toss between the Goldring GR 1 and the Pro-Ject Debut III. While both the Goldring and Pro-Ject were almost at the same price, and the Goldring is more popular than Pro-Ject, Audio Den packaged the Pro-Ject with an extra Grado cartridge, thus I settled for the Pro-Ject. It is in the mid-level TTs, again, it's a toss between the Pro-Ject 1xpression, the goldring GR 1.2, with the Technics MK 1200 coming in close. But there's the Cartridge Factor: KOETSU. between the Goldring GR1.2 and the Pro-Ject, there is quite a positive feedback on the Pro-Ject KOETSU combination, rather the the GR 1.2, thus I again settled for the Pro-Ject. What do I like about the Pro-Ject, especially the 1xpression: Well, it's an idiot's TT... not much fancy looking, it's all about functionality at an affordable price. It's tonearm is made of Carbon Fibre, less ringing compared to it's predecessor. Plus, the fact that you can easily adjust VTA, VTF, Anti-skate and Azimuth, the user can learn how a change in a particular setting can alter the sound. The AC motor is isolated from the plinth using rubber bands... quite simple such that one wonders why the need for a complex isolation.
